Overview
You will join the Risk Management Department of Intesa Sanpaolo Assicurazioni, within the Non-Life Risk office, where you will be responsible for monitoring and assessing natural catastrophe risks (earthquake, flood, hail, and landslide) for the insurance portfolio. You will contribute to the development of quantitative models, scenario analyses, and stress tests, supporting ORSA (Own Risk and Solvency Assessment) processes, underwriting strategies, and reinsurance programs.
What your activities will be
• Assess and monitor natural catastrophe risks (earthquake, flood, hail, landslide) related to the Intesa Sanpaolo Protezione insurance portfolio.
• Analyze exposure to natural risks, identifying risk concentrations and territorial accumulations.
• Use and develop catastrophe models to estimate expected losses, extreme losses, and capital impacts.
• Perform scenario analyses and stress tests to support Risk Management activities and the ORSA process.
• Collaborate with Underwriting, Actuarial, and Reinsurance functions in defining risk assumption and mitigation strategies.
• Support the design and optimization of reinsurance programs through quantitative analysis of catastrophe risk.
• Monitor key risk indicators (KRI) and prepare periodic reporting for management and control bodies.
• Analyze the impacts of catastrophic events on the insurance portfolio and prepare post-event assessments.
•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ements (e.g., Solvency II) related to catastrophe risks.
• Contribute to the evolution of risk assessment methodologies by integrating new data sources, analytical tools, and predictive models.
